Style Tip: Ditch The Blouse and Sport A Tee Instead

The effortless vibes that the casual tee imparts makes it a consitent wardrobe staple. However, in 2017, the comfortable garment will not just be reserved for weekend wear or off-duty style.

You’ve probably already seen a rise in the new mix of glam meets casual, but as we progress into the new year, you’ll be seeing a lot more of it. The twist will be that words and slogans, such as “Love” or “We Should All Be Feminists,” will be splashed across the front. I recently sported this casually glam combination during a trip down in Miami. Since I had been invited to several events, late-evening birthday dinners, and after-hour lounges, I knew the slogan tee (here) was making the flight with me seconds after laying eyes on it. The same was true for the ruffled mini (here).

However, what I didn’t think of right out the gate was styling this combo. I had brought the tee to wear with jean shorts during the day and had packed a silk, black blouse for pairing with the shiny, black mini. After feeling too overdone in the all black blouse and skirt ensemble, it came to me to swap out the sophisticated blouse for the laid-back tee. Instantly, I felt better about hopping from place to place, as I’d be so much more comfortable and wouldn’t look like I had spent an hour destroying my hotel room.
